Output 621bca5630ec2ca516be8df36b5165baf1969d760c566f7afd7fcb54dbb18cd8:1

value
533228
script pubkey
OP_0 OP_PUSHBYTES_20 16ddd370a136dbee6c004dc367884e956c6f144c
address
bc1qzmwaxu9pxmd7umqqfhpk0zzwj4kx79zvxd826w
transaction
621bca5630ec2ca516be8df36b5165baf1969d760c566f7afd7fcb54dbb18cd8
confirmations
17005
spent
true